Transaction 6708c05d3c433b5410216236470c30b486b54df7cbfe4b9f263025a90500fb6a
1 Input
1 Output
-
6708c05d3c433b5410216236470c30b486b54df7cbfe4b9f263025a90500fb6a:0
- value
- 2478117
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aeaaea4363f6b0f86b644b76f554a94faac8285
- address
- bc1qdt42afpk8a4slp4kgjmk7422jna2eq59dsa0vd